Transaction 5cee5a3211719608d3c074ffd765fe7e6cc216ff7e1e6f66dc0c1ac40364c52b

6 Input
2 Outputs
  • 5cee5a3211719608d3c074ffd765fe7e6cc216ff7e1e6f66dc0c1ac40364c52b:0
  • value  1018962
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 5cee5a3211719608d3c074ffd765fe7e6cc216ff7e1e6f66dc0c1ac40364c52b:1
  • value  21500811
    address  3JJoEote36RZugwtSG9E7j8AAh6Wd3dZDL